3. Tracking Technologies and Analytics

We use various tracking technologies to analyze website performance, understand user behavior, and improve our services. These technologies are implemented through Google Tag Manager (GTM) and include:

3.1 Google Tag Manager (GTM)

We use Google Tag Manager to manage and deploy various tracking tags on our website. GTM itself does not collect personal information but enables other tracking tools to function.

3.2 Google Analytics

We use Google Analytics to collect and analyze information about how visitors use our website. Google Analytics uses cookies to track:

Google Analytics data is retained for 26 months. You can opt out of Google Analytics by installing the Google Analytics Opt-out Browser Add-on.

3.3 Facebook Pixel

We use Facebook Pixel to measure the effectiveness of our advertising campaigns and to deliver targeted advertisements. Facebook Pixel tracks:

Facebook may use this information to show you relevant ads on Facebook and Instagram. You can control ad preferences in your Facebook Ad Settings.

3.4 Microsoft Clarity

We use Microsoft Clarity to understand how users interact with our website through session recordings and heatmaps. Microsoft Clarity collects:

Microsoft Clarity anonymizes personal information and does not collect sensitive data like passwords or payment information. Learn more about Microsoft Clarity Privacy.
